How much do internship graphic engineer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 20,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ship graphic engineer in the United States is $16.33,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$19.23 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an internship graphic engineer do?

An Internship Graphic Engineer assists in designing, developing, and optimizing graphic systems and visual elements for software or hardware products. Their work often involves supporting senior engineers in creating 2D or 3D graphics, testing visual assets, and troubleshooting graphic-related issues. Interns typically gain hands-on experience with graphics APIs, rendering pipelines, and may contribute to projects related to gaming, simulations, or user interfaces. This role is ideal for students or recent graduates who want to build practical skills in computer graphics and visual computing.

What kinds of projects and responsibilities can an internship graphic engineer expect during their internship?

As an Internship Graphic Engineer, you can expect to work on tasks such as assisting with the development of rendering engines, optimizing graphical performance, and collaborating on visual effects for games or applications. You'll often shadow senior engineers, participate in code reviews, and contribute to debugging and testing graphics features. This role typically involves close teamwork with artists, game designers, and other engineers, offering a well-rounded perspective on the graphics pipeline. The experience gained is highly valuable for building technical skills and understanding collaborative workflows in a professional environ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an internship graphic eng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Internship Graphic Engineer, you need a solid foundation in computer graphics principles, programming (such as C++ or Python), and a relevant academic background in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with graphics APIs like OpenGL, DirectX, or Vulkan, as well as experience with 3D modeling tools or shader programming, is highly valuable. Creativity, strong problem-solving skills, and effective communication help interns collaborate with teams and contribute innovative ideas. These competencies ensure the ability to learn quickly, support complex projects, and effectively integrate into professional development environments.

What is the difference between Internship Graphic Engineer vs Graphic Designer?

AspectInternship Graphic EngineerGraphic Designer
Required CredentialsBasic knowledge of graphic design, some technical skills, possibly enrolled in related studiesFormal education or training in graphic design or visual arts
Work EnvironmentInternship setting, often in tech or engineering firms, collaborative projectsDesign studios, marketing departments, freelance work
Employer & Industry UsageTech companies, engineering firms, startupsAdvertising agencies, media companies, corporate marketing

Internship Graphic Engineers typically focus on technical aspects of graphic design within engineering contexts, often as part of an internship program. Graphic Designers have a broader creative role, emphasizing visual communication and branding. Both roles may overlap in skills but differ mainly in technical focus and industry application.
